Join us for a workshop that will help you unravel the mystery of the first stage of grant proposal development. The “Pursuing Grant Funding: Preapplication Best Practices” workshop will help answer key questions in preproposal planning, such as:

  • What departmental or programmatic need at NOVA are you addressing?
  • Does your project idea align with the funder’s priorities?
  • What type of data and research support your needs statement?
  • What type of internal (deans, provosts) and external (partners) support do you need?
